Worm infections that usually occur in the limbs of both hands and feet are cutaneous migraine larvae or creeping eruption. But from your father's disease, it is not necessarily a cutaneous migraine larvae because you do not explain what complaints occur and do not explain how the signs and symptoms on your father's feet. So the treatment given is not clear, because the diagnosis of the disease has also not been directed.
Right now your father should do is:
Always use footwear when walking.
Wash your hands diligently.
Maintain personal and environmental hygiene.
Avoid excessive scratching because it can cause secondary infections.
Immediately consult a doctor to see the condition of your father's feet directly and do consultations on complaints that are felt.
